    Well, to start, we were moving this weekend. well, as I started my Bronco saturday morning, I heard a not so nice noise coming from my motor. well, it turns out, that I blew out a crank bearing!!! it was moving a good inch or so, by the looks of the harmonic balancer going in and out! so needless to say, my tow vehicle is out of commision for god knows how long. I have to try and find another motor. it has a 302 that was punched .60 over. I am going to look for a 351 now I guess. funds are way limited after just moving. boat will have to sit for a while!
